## **Core Functions and Benefits**

Automated strip packaging machines, also known as blister packers, create secure, unit-dose packages by forming a pocket (blister) from a thermoplastic film, placing the product inside, and sealing it with a lidding material (often foil). The primary benefits are substantial:

* **Enhanced Efficiency:** These systems operate at high speeds, dramatically increasing output compared to manual packaging. They streamline the production process, reducing bottlenecks.
* **Unmatched Accuracy:** Automated feeding and sealing eliminate human error, ensuring every strip contains the correct product count and that seals are tamper-evident and consistent.
* **Improved Product Integrity:** The sealed strips protect contents from moisture, contamination, and physical damage, extending shelf life.
* **Cost Reduction:** While an initial investment, they lower long-term labor costs, minimize material waste from errors, and reduce product loss.

## **Detailed Function Breakdown**

**

How the Packaging Process Works

**
The operation is a seamless, continuous cycle. First, a forming web is heated and molded into cavities. Products are precisely deposited into these cavities. A lidding web is then applied and heat-sealed onto the formed web. Finally, the sealed blister sheets are die-cut into individual strips or packs, ready for cartoning.

**

Key Machine Components

**
Understanding the main parts clarifies the machine’s reliability:
* **Unwinding & Forming Station:** Manages the base film and forms blisters.
* **Product Feeding System:** Accurately counts and places items into blisters (vibratory feeders, rotary feeders).
* **Sealing Station:** Applies heat and pressure to bond the lidding material.
* **Cutting & Slitting Unit:** Cuts the continuous blister sheet into final strip dimensions.
* **Control Panel (HMI):** The user interface for monitoring and adjusting all parameters.

## **Addressing Common Queries**

**

What industries use these machines?

**
They are vital in **pharmaceuticals** (tablets, capsules), **food** (small candies, lozenges), **electronics** (components), and **consumer goods** (batteries, adhesives).

**

How to choose the right machine?

**
Consider your **product type and size**, required **output speed**, **packaging materials**, and necessary **compliance standards** (e.g., FDA, GMP for pharmaceuticals). Partnering with a reputable supplier is crucial for a tailored solution.

**

What about maintenance?

**
Regular cleaning, lubrication of moving parts, and inspection of seals and cutters are essential. Modern machines often feature self-diagnostic systems to preempt issues.
